Leuchars station is well-equipped to make your journey smooth and comfortable. The ticket office operates from 06:20 to 21:45 on weekdays and Saturdays, and 10:10 to 22:15 on Sundays.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are accessible, and they support the collection of tickets purchased online. Accessibility is a priority, with step-free access to certain parts of the station, and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ments.
Waiting comfortably for your train is made easy with seating areas available throughout the station, although there's no first-class lounge. The station provides public Wi-Fi, payphones, and CCTV for added security. For those requiring assistance, staff help is available during ticket office hours, ensuring you get the help you need, whether it’s from the office or through the customer help points.

Unlike major rail hubs, Bellgrove Station is more intimate, lacking a ticket office, but offers ticket machines for all your travel needs. This makes it convenient to collect tickets previously purchased online. The station is equipped with smartcard validators for seamless commuting. While accessibility might pose a challenge with its Category C status—implying no step-free access—it's important to plan accordingly if mobility is a concern. Unfortunately, there are no toilets and refreshment facilities on the premises, but CCTV ensures a level of security for your travel experience.
For travelers requiring assistance, dedicated customer help points are available, providing vital information through departure screens and announcements. Although staff assistance is limited, the station’s induction loop can aid those with hearing impairments.
Bellgrove offers a range of onward travel options, making it accessible for those keen to explore Glasgow and beyond. For a smooth transfer, buses are available directly from the Bellgrove Street station entrance. NextBike offers convenient cycle hire near the station if you prefer a greener mode of exploration. For detailed bus services, travelers can refer to Travel Line Scotland. Taxis are readily available for hire, and you can find more information on services by visiting Train Taxi. Rail replacement services are also active, ensuring smooth travel continuity even amidst railway work.
